How to touch up hair roots at home?
Step 1 If you only
need to color your roots, choose a shade that you usually use for uncolored
roots or a shade closest to your base color. If you choose a new shade, the
chart will help you predict the coloring result according to your natural hair
color.
Step 2 Carefully
read the instructions and follow them.
Step 3 Be sure to
carry out an allergy test 48 hours before coloring.
Step 4 Brush dry,
unwashed hair. Cover your shoulders with a towel to prevent the dye from getting
on them. Apply a rich cream to the skin of the face that comes into contact
with the hair – this will make it easier to remove the dye from the skin.
Step 5 Put on the
gloves included in the kit. In a non-metallic bowl, mix all the cream colorant
and the developer milk (you can mix half of the components).
Step 6 Start
applying to the roots. Move from the back of the head to the temples. Apply the
mixture evenly, leaving no gaps. Use non-metallic clips or hair ties to secure
the hair if needed.
Step 7 Make sure
the mixture is evenly distributed over all roots. Leave on for 15 minutes
(25 minutes if you have a lot of gray hair or if it is a lightening color).
Step 8 After leaving the mixture on the
roots for 15-25 minutes, quickly and evenly distribute the remaining mixture
along the entire length of the hair. This will help achieve a more uniform
color.
Step 9 Leave the dye for another 5-10
minutes. The total processing time should not exceed 35 minutes (30 minutes for
lightening dyes).
